#' CloudWatch RUM
#'
#' @description
#' With Amazon CloudWatch RUM, you can perform real-user monitoring to
#' collect client-side data about your web application performance from
#' actual user sessions in real time. The data collected includes page load
#' times, client-side errors, and user behavior. When you view this data,
#' you can see it all aggregated together and also see breakdowns by the
#' browsers and devices that your customers use.
#' 
#' You can use the collected data to quickly identify and debug client-side
#' performance issues. CloudWatch RUM helps you visualize anomalies in your
#' application performance and find relevant debugging data such as error
#' messages, stack traces, and user sessions. You can also use RUM to
#' understand the range of end-user impact including the number of users,
#' geolocations, and browsers used.

#' @section Operations:
#' \tabular{ll}{
#'  \link[=cloudwatchrum_batch_create_rum_metric_definitions]{batch_create_rum_metric_definitions} \tab Specifies the extended metrics and custom metrics that you want a CloudWatch RUM app monitor to send to a destination\cr
#'  \link[=cloudwatchrum_batch_delete_rum_metric_definitions]{batch_delete_rum_metric_definitions} \tab Removes the specified metrics from being sent to an extended metrics destination\cr
#'  \link[=cloudwatchrum_batch_get_rum_metric_definitions]{batch_get_rum_metric_definitions} \tab Retrieves the list of metrics and dimensions that a RUM app monitor is sending to a single destination\cr
#'  \link[=cloudwatchrum_create_app_monitor]{create_app_monitor} \tab Creates a Amazon CloudWatch RUM app monitor, which collects telemetry data from your application and sends that data to RUM\cr
#'  \link[=cloudwatchrum_delete_app_monitor]{delete_app_monitor} \tab Deletes an existing app monitor\cr
#'  \link[=cloudwatchrum_delete_rum_metrics_destination]{delete_rum_metrics_destination} \tab Deletes a destination for CloudWatch RUM extended metrics, so that the specified app monitor stops sending extended metrics to that destination\cr
#'  \link[=cloudwatchrum_get_app_monitor]{get_app_monitor} \tab Retrieves the complete configuration information for one app monitor\cr
#'  \link[=cloudwatchrum_get_app_monitor_data]{get_app_monitor_data} \tab Retrieves the raw performance events that RUM has collected from your web application, so that you can do your own processing or analysis of this data\cr
#'  \link[=cloudwatchrum_list_app_monitors]{list_app_monitors} \tab Returns a list of the Amazon CloudWatch RUM app monitors in the account\cr
#'  \link[=cloudwatchrum_list_rum_metrics_destinations]{list_rum_metrics_destinations} \tab Returns a list of destinations that you have created to receive RUM extended metrics, for the specified app monitor\cr
#'  \link[=cloudwatchrum_list_tags_for_resource]{list_tags_for_resource} \tab Displays the tags associated with a CloudWatch RUM resource\cr
#'  \link[=cloudwatchrum_put_rum_events]{put_rum_events} \tab Sends telemetry events about your application performance and user behavior to CloudWatch RUM\cr
#'  \link[=cloudwatchrum_put_rum_metrics_destination]{put_rum_metrics_destination} \tab Creates or updates a destination to receive extended metrics from CloudWatch RUM\cr
#'  \link[=cloudwatchrum_tag_resource]{tag_resource} \tab Assigns one or more tags (key-value pairs) to the specified CloudWatch RUM resource\cr
#'  \link[=cloudwatchrum_untag_resource]{untag_resource} \tab Removes one or more tags from the specified resource\cr
#'  \link[=cloudwatchrum_update_app_monitor]{update_app_monitor} \tab Updates the configuration of an existing app monitor\cr
#'  \link[=cloudwatchrum_update_rum_metric_definition]{update_rum_metric_definition} \tab Modifies one existing metric definition for CloudWatch RUM extended metrics
#' }
